The Strength of the Lord

Overview: Psalms 4-6, Acts 13:13-52

These Psalms contrast the experience of the righteous to the wicked. Because of their trust in the Lord, the righteous know that God hears their prayers. Knowing this brings relief, peace, and joy even in the midst of suffering. 

In his sermon in a synagogue, Paul teaches that Jesus is the fulfillment of Old Testament promises. After the Jewish opposition forces him out, he and Barnabas turn to the Gentiles with their Gospel. 

The Bible uses contrasts to illustrate how God’s way differs from the world. Do you face life’s challenges with your own strength or with God’s?
